Transaction 5b477927e33f5c69674eb8b881dba99e43dabda96cc48ed209cc6aa982693a34
1 Input
1 Output
-
5b477927e33f5c69674eb8b881dba99e43dabda96cc48ed209cc6aa982693a34:0
- value
- 88644
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6be1c1a3c92b2e3d55ce3368516851b2f4b2c8c OP_EQUAL
- address
- 3MGUGeu4iE624uZNairVpFpurfYYXw4MHy